UN R117: Proposal to amend the 02, 03 and 04 series of amendments

Proposal to allow the use of LT-marked tyres under certain conditions and weight limits with a rolling resistance greater than the current limits.

GRBP | Session 79 | 6-9 Feb 2024

26. The expert from AAPC presented draft amendments that allowed, under certain conditions and weight limits, the use of LT-marked tyres with a rolling resistance greater than the current limits in UN Regulation No. 117 (ECE/TRANS/WP.29/GRBP/2024/17). The experts from Japan and the United Kingdom indicated that the proposed amendments would lead to relaxation of the current requirements. The expert from France pointed out that he would need more time to study the consequences of the proposal. GRBP agreed to continue consideration of this matter at the next session.

GRBP | Session 80 | 17-20 Sep 2024

28. The expert from AAPC recalled that, at the previous session, they had presented the proposal in ECE/TRANS/WP.29/GRBP/2024/17 that allowed, under certain conditions and weight limits, the use of LT-marked tyres with a rolling resistance greater than the current limits in UN Regulation No. 117. Following comments by the experts from France, Italy, Netherlands, Switzerland and United Kingdom, GRBP was not in a position to support the proposal and indicated that such exemptions should be granted at the national or regional levels. Taking into account the GRBP views, the expert from AAPC agreed to withdraw the document and to pursue the issue at the regional level.
